Specialized equipment and trailers

Concrete pumpers vary in length, height, and axle spread, so trailer choice has to match the machine. We commonly use RGNs, lowboys, step decks, double drops, and multi-axle trailers depending on boom configuration and total weight. A truck-mounted pumper may ride differently than a trailer-mounted unit, and that changes how we set up securement, deck height, and clearance planning. Heavy Haul Transporting evaluates the center of gravity, overhang, and attachment points before dispatch. Our fleet also accounts for removable boom sections, outriggers, and accessories that may travel with the machine as part of the same oversize load. Flatbed trucking companies can move many machines, but concrete pumpers often need a more specialized setup than standard flatbed shipping companies provide. The goal is simple: match the equipment to the load so the road move stays within legal height, width, and weight limits while protecting the machine in transit.

Permits, escort requirements, and route planning

Florida oversize hauling takes planning, especially when a concrete pumper leaves Port of Panama City, FL and heads inland on public roads. We review permit dimensions, axle weights, bridge limits, and height restrictions before the truck ever rolls. Depending on the load profile, escort vehicles may be required, and route surveys can help avoid low clearances, tight turns, construction zones, and weight-sensitive bridges. The main corridors near Panama City, including US-98, SR-77, and connections toward I-10, can shape the route choice for oversized load trucking. Heavy Haulers work through these details early so the move does not stall at a narrow interchange or a restricted span. Heavy Haulers also coordinate timing around traffic patterns and daylight travel rules where applicable. This is where over-dimensional hauling becomes a planning job, not just a driving job, and every mile has to be mapped before departure.
